Abstract

Coalbed methane is becoming become an important component of the world's natural gas resource. To date, researchers have mostly investigated the permeability changes due to non-linear elastic deformation caused by a matrix shrinkage associated with methane desorption. However, the effect of linear elastic deformation of coal matrix due to stress variation has not been considered. This paper focuses on the importance of understanding the relationship between vertical deviatoric stress-induced internal fracturing (within coal matrix) and the resulting permeability variation. Evaluation of changes in permeability as a result of stress changes that are caused by vertical deviatoric stress (effective vertical deviatoric stress) has been discussed.
